Winter Estates Auction

Catalog Information: 1,204 lots | 718 with images

Date: 2004

Auction House:

Neal Auction Company

Location:

USA

Lot 1: A Pair of Louis XVI-Style Creme Peinte and Parcel Giltwood Pedestals

each of square tapering columnar form, decorated with pendant bows and swags, height 44 in.

 
Subscribe/sign in to see full-sized image

Lot 2: A Continental Silver and Tortoiseshell Reliquary Vessel

early 18th c., of faceted tapered form, the bottom bearing an inscription "IHS/SOID JV/ANGAR/ZIA", the top engraved "AND 1722", height 4 1/2 in.

 
Subscribe/sign in to see full-sized image

Lot 3: A Group of Four Victorian Tortoiseshell Objects

mid-to-late 19th c., comprising a card case, two coin purses and a miniature guitar, height of largest 4 1/2 in.

 
Subscribe/sign in to see full-sized image

Lot 4: A Small French Ivory and Gilt Cased Sewing Kit

c. 1840, comprising an oval fitted case with hinged cover with scissors and matching thimble

 
Subscribe/sign in to see full-sized image

Lot 5: A Rare English or French Carved and Ebonized Wood Blackamoor

late 19th c., standing figure holding a shallow circular tray, his face inlaid with glass eyes and bone or ivory teeth, on a rectangular plinth, height 18 in., width 8 in., depth 12 in.
